Posted: Tue Dec 14, 2010 2:33 am
by ki6rjw
I use the Astron LS18 power supply, which is a 24V power supply, easily adjusted up to 30V and a Pyramid PS26K that is already on my bench for the 12V side. I adapted the stock power cord and added a pair of 15A fuses on the 30V side pos and neg and a pair of 5A fuses on the 12V pos and neg side. Has worked like a charm since and is by far cheaper then repairing or replacing the original FP29 switching power supply. Look for the Astron LS18 used and they can be had for a good price, I got mine on the fleabay for $105 shipped.
